| Section 5. The Illinois Municipal Code is amended by |
| 5 |
| changing Section 2-3-5a as follows:
|
| 6 |
| (65 ILCS 5/2-3-5a) (from Ch. 24, par. 2-3-5a)
|
| 7 |
| Sec. 2-3-5a. Incorporation of village.
|
| 8 |
| (a) Whenever in any county of 150,000 or more population as |
| 9 |
| determined by
the last preceding federal census any area of |
| 10 |
| contiguous territory contains
at least 4 square miles and 2500 |
| 11 |
| inhabitants residing in permanent
dwellings, that area may be |
| 12 |
| incorporated as a village if a petition filed
by 250 electors |
| 13 |
| residing within that area is filed with the circuit clerk
of |
| 14 |
| the county in which such area is located addressed to the |
| 15 |
| circuit court
for that county. The petition must set forth:
|
| 16 |
| (1) a legal description of the area intended to be |
| 17 |
| included
in the proposed village,
|
| 18 |
| (2) the number of residents in that area,
|
| 19 |
| (3) the name of the proposed village, and
|
| 20 |
| (4) a prayer that the question of the incorporation of |
| 21 |
| the
area as a village be submitted to the electors residing |
| 22 |
| within the limits of
the proposed village.
|
| 23 |
| If the area contains fewer than 7,500 residents and lies |
| 24 |
| within 1 1/2 miles
of the limits of any existing municipality, |
| 25 |
| the consent of that municipality
must be obtained before the |
| 26 |
| area may be incorporated.
